Facebook is seeking an Android Software Engineer for the Spatial Computing team within XR Tech/Facebook Reality Labs. You will be responsible for developing and maintaining the Mapillary Android App and SDK. You will also be responsible for developing new Android applications for improving map data.
Android Software Engineer Responsibilities
  • Develop and maintain the Mapillary family of Android apps and SDK
  • IWork closely with our product and design teams to build new and innovative application experiences for Android
  • Implement custom native user interfaces using the latest Android programming techniques
  • Build reusable Android software components for interfacing with our back-end platforms
  • Analyze and optimize UI and infrastructure application code for quality, efficiency, and performance
Minimum Qualifications
  • Experience building Android applications in Java using Android SDK
  • Object-oriented software development experience
  • Experience building maintainable and testable code bases, including API design and unit testing techniques
  • Experience with multithreading programming and mobile memory management
  • Experience in understanding code bases, including API design techniques
  • Experience with Java language and frameworks
  • Experience with Multi-Threading and memory management specific to mobile devices
  • Experience with caching mechanisms
  • Knowledge on UI design principles and making apps work
Preferred Qualifications
  • Experience developing Android applications from start to finish
  • Experience with network programming and custom UIs
  • Experience with technologies and languages like JNI, C/C++, and Kotlin
